File 通过或 进行 缓存 Redis : 哪个选项适合您的应用程序?

缓存是提高应用程序性能和减少主数据源负载的关键元素。 file 在构建应用程序时,决定是否通过或 使用缓存 Redis 取决于多种因素。 以下是这两种方法之间的比较,可帮助您为您的应用程序做出最佳决策。

缓存通过 File

优点:

  • 轻松部署: 通过实现缓存 file 非常简单,不需要在应用程序外部进行额外的安装。
  • 适合小型项目: 对于小型或简单的项目,使用缓存通过 file 可以简单有效。

缺点:

  • 性能有限: 高速缓存 file 在处理高频数据访问任务时可能会存在性能限制。
  • 管理面临的挑战: 随着应用程序的扩展和缓存的 file 增长,管理和维护缓存可能会变得更加复杂。

缓存通过 Redis

优点:

  • 高性能: Redis 是一个快速而强大的缓存系统,适合有高性能要求的应用程序。
  • 支持多种数据类型: Redis 支持多种数据类型,不仅可以存储简单数据,还可以存储列表、集合等复杂数据结构。
  • 更好的管理: Redis 提供更好的缓存管理和控制功能,允许您定义缓存过期限制并在需要时自动清除缓存。

缺点:

  • 复杂的配置和部署: Redis 与cache via相比,需要更复杂的配置和部署 file,特别是当您需要设置和管理专用 Redis 服务器时。

最终决定

file 在决定是否通过或 来使用缓存时 Redis,请考虑项目规模、复杂程度、性能需求、数据结构需求和缓存管理能力等因素。 如果您的应用程序需要高性能并支持多种数据类型,那么 Redis 它可能是一个不错的选择。 相反,如果您正在构建一个小型且简单的项目,那么使用缓存via file 可能足以满足您的需求。